Why Sleep Matters for Your Skin


Consider the time you spend sleeping as the skin's internal clock. As you drift off to sleep, incredible things occur:


●    Stress Less, Glow More: 


Lack of sleep causes an increase in cortisol production, a stress hormone that destroys collagen and has a devastating effect on the skin. More creases and less plumpness will show up as a result of this.


●    Repair and Recharge: 


Your skin's natural repair process occurs during sleep. Repairing damage caused by daily aggressors like pollution and UV rays is facilitated by cellular turnover, which goes into high gear during this time. The skin also becomes plumper and more elastic as a result of an increase in collagen production.


●    Daytime Defense: 


The night is the perfect time to prepare your skin for the day ahead by applying a protective layer. To slow down the aging process, it's like donning a protective barrier against harmful free radicals and environmental stresses.

Are you prepared to perform your beauty sleep ritual? How about we delve into the fundamentals of a radiant awakening:


Step 1: Melt Away the Day (Makeup Remover):


Picture your face after a long day, covered in sunblock, makeup, and the grime of the city. Oh no! Using a gentle, skin-type-appropriate makeup remover, sweep it all away. Micellar water provides a revitalizing wash, and balm cleansers dissolve even the most entrenched makeup without drying out your skin.


Step 2: Cleanse Deeply (Cleanser):


After you've removed all of your makeup, it's time to give your face a more thorough wash. To avoid drying out your skin, use a mild cleanser that gets rid of grime, oil, and any remaining residue. Choose a product with a regulated pH to keep your skin from getting irritated, particularly if it's sensitive.


Step 3: Exfoliate for Radiance (Exfoliant):


Exfoliate your skin gently two or three times weekly. By exfoliating, this method brings out the skin's natural glow and smoothness. If you have sensitive skin, it's best to stick to chemical exfoliants like AHAs or BHAs, physical exfoliants like gentle scrubs, or enzyme exfoliants like plant-based enzymes. Exfoliating too vigorously might cause more damage than benefit, so be careful.


Step 4: Target Your Concerns (Serum):


Serums are like little vials of concentrated magic. Skin issues, including dryness, uneven tone, and wrinkles, can be targeted with these products because of the powerful chemicals they contain. Retinol fights wrinkles and UV damage, and hyaluronic acid serums flood the skin with moisture. Pick a serum that complements your present objectives; after all, a little is plenty!


Step 5: Seal in the Goodness (Moisturizer):


Keep your skin well-hydrated no matter what it is. To seal in all the benefits of the preceding stages, choose a moisturizer that caters to your specific needs. Get an oil-free alternative if your skin is prone to acne, a rich cream if your skin is dry, and a lightweight formulation if your skin is oily. The skin's protective barrier is fortified with ingredients like ceramides, while peptides boost collagen production.


Step 6: Pamper Your Eyes (Eye Cream):


Take extra care of the sensitive area around your eyes. If you suffer from under-eye bags, dark circles, or wrinkles, try using an eye cream. To reduce puffiness, moisturize with hyaluronic acid, and stimulate collagen formation with peptides, search for a formula that has these elements. Pat the substance into the orbital bone gently, being careful not to tug.


Step 7: Boost Overnight (Mask):


For a little extra TLC, try using an overnight mask once or twice weekly. These topical remedies are designed to tackle specific concerns by delivering concentrated amounts of active substances. While brightening masks aim to eliminate dullness and uneven tone, hydrating masks swell and moisturize dry skin. A wonderful way to wake up is with a revitalized, glowing complexion, and sleeping masks are just the ticket.

Sleep Accessories for Extra Glow


●    Humidifier: 


Humidifiers that produce a cool mist can help alleviate the skin-drying effects of dry air. For a more relaxing night's sleep, try diffusing some lavender or other calming essential oil. Always perform a small area test before applying any essential oil to your skin, especially your face, because some of these oils can be unpleasant.


●    Silk Sleep Mask: 


A soft silk mask can block out light and keep wrinkles at bay as you sleep. Your skin can benefit greatly from this little indulgence. In contrast to cotton, which stretches and wrinkles easily, silk is smooth and mild on the skin. On top of that, silk helps regulate temperature and is inherently breathable so that it won't clog pores from night sweats.


●    Pillowcases: 


Think about splurging on some luxurious satin or silk pillowcases. All the advantages of a silk sleep mask—less friction, less wrinkles from sleep, and mild on the skin and hair—are yours to enjoy with these materials. If nighttime warmth is a problem for you, it's worth it to invest in a cooling fabric.


●    Comfort is Key:


●    Your general health and the condition of your skin are profoundly affected by how well you sleep.

●    Get some high-quality bedding that will both keep you warm and help you unwind at night.

●    You should think about the firmness of the mattress, the kind of pillows you use, and whether you want sheets made of cotton or bamboo, which allow air to circulate.

Going Above and Beyond Creating the Perfect Beauty Sleep Sanctuary
It takes more than just a good skincare regimen to create an atmosphere that encourages a good night's sleep and healthy skin. If you want to make your bedroom a relaxing sanctuary where you can rejuvenate, consider these further suggestions:


●    Setting the Stage:


Comfortable coolness is ideal, so aim for a temperature of 60–67°F (15–19°C). This keeps your core temperature stable and stops you from sweating during the night, which keeps your pores clear.


●    Light: 


If you want to sleep well, you need a dark room. Get some blackout drapes or a face mask to keep the light out.


●    Digital Detox: 


The blue light that screens emit disturbs people's natural sleep cycles. Do not use any electronic devices, including phones and laptops, for at least one hour before going to bed.


●    Relaxing Scents: 


To set the mood for relaxation and tranquility, try diffusing some essential oils, such as chamomile or lavender.


●    Soothing Sounds: 


To block out disturbing sounds and get a better night's rest, try listening to white noise or natural sounds.


Beyond the Bedroom


●    Exercise Regularly: 


Get some exercise before bed to help you sleep better, but don't push yourself too hard right before you turn in. A soothing yoga or stretching session an hour before bedtime is a good choice.


●    Mindfulness & Relaxation Techniques: 


To calm your thoughts and get ready for sleep, try some relaxation techniques like progressive muscle relaxation, deep breathing, or meditation.


●    Manage stress: 


Poor sleep quality is one symptom of chronic stress. Find ways to relax, such as meditating, deep breathing, or doing yoga.


●    Hydration is Key: 


To keep your skin hydrated and get a good night's rest, drink lots of water during the day and cut back on coffee and alcohol, particularly in the late hours.


●    Diet for Beauty Sleep: 


To avoid blood sugar spikes and poor sleep quality, cut back on processed and sugary foods in the hours leading up to bedtime. For better digestion and relaxation, eat light, nutrient-rich meals.


●    Get regular sunlight exposure: 


Get at least half an hour of sunshine every day to assist your circadian rhythm.
